#ad84d5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ad84d5 is composed of 67.8% red, 51.8%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.8% cyan, 38%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 270.4 degrees, a saturation of 49.1% and a lightness of 67.6%. #ad84d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5b09ab.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#ad84d5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ad84d5 has RGB values of R:173, G:132,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 11371733.

Hex triplet ad84d5 #ad84d5
RGB Decimal 173, 132, 213 rgb(173,132,213)
RGB Percent 67.8, 51.8, 83.5 rgb(67.8%,51.8%,83.5%)
CMYK 19, 38, 0, 16
HSL 270.4°, 49.1, 67.6 hsl(270.4,49.1%,67.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 270.4°, 38, 83.5
Web Safe 9999cc #9999cc
CIE-LAB 61.819, 31.271, -35.772
XYZ 37.493, 30.191, 66.799
xyY 0.279, 0.224, 30.191
CIE-LCH 61.819, 47.513, 311.16
CIE-LUV 61.819, 15.488, -60.25
Hunter-Lab 54.947, 25.644, -33.617
Binary 10101101, 10000100, 11010101

Shades and Tints of #ad84d5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060309 is the darkest color, while #fbf9fd is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#ad84d5 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#999999 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#9d95a5 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#7f98e1 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#8699d2 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#a696a1 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#9091dc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#9491d3 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#a88fb3 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
